I've never read the book, but I'm a huge Nightmare Before Christmas fan, and I love Neil Gaiman's stuff, so their new stop-motion animated film "Coraline" (http://www.imdb.com/title/tt0327597/) definitely has me intrigued. It also has a great cast: Dakota Fanning as the titular heroine, Teri Hatcher, Keith David (whoohoo!), Ian McShane, Jennifer Saunders, and Dawn French. Sorry to disappoint the TMBG fans, but recently John Flansburgh said in an interview that all but one of their songs were cut from the movie.



A shame. I was looking forward to this movie mainly because they were doing the music for it.

Bit of trivia: Their song "Careful What You Pack" from The Else was recorded for this movie but was cut early on.
